In August 2007, Mahalo introduced the Mahalo Follow toolbar while its "How To" pages gained more attention. Blogger Robert Scoble also wrote a favorable post regarding Facebook, TechMeme and Mahalo that generated much attention.
-
How Tos
Travel blog Gadling posted about Mahalo's travel "how to" articles, most specifically How to Fly With Kids. Gadling found the article "useful," and the How To category has since expanded to cover more topics.Gadling: Mahalo on How to Fly With Kids (August 2, 2007) -
Mahalo Follow
At the Gnomedex conference on August 10, Mahalo CEO Jason Calacanis launched the Mahalo Follow Firefox toolbar. With it, users could simultaneously search on Google and see Mahalo results via sidebar.ReadWriteWeb: Mahalo Launches Toolbar - Aims to Convert Google Users (August 10, 2007)If Mahalo did not have a search results page for a subject, the sidebar would not pop up.
-
Scoble
On his blog Scobleizer, Robert Scoble stated in an August 26 post that "SEO-resistant technologies" like Mahalo, TechMeme and Facebook would "kick Google’s butt in four years."Scobleizer: Why Mahalo, TechMeme, and Facebook are going to kick Google’s butt in four years (August 26, 2007)His comments were met with heavy criticism from skeptics, but a few found "some validity" to his statements.CNET Asia: "Scoble can't be more wrong" (August 29, 2007)
